Transaction 3c43fca70fb06b01c96f5b2cc67eaf08cee909ebdf5e37ec3a25b4fa253081d3
2 Input
2 Outputs
- 3c43fca70fb06b01c96f5b2cc67eaf08cee909ebdf5e37ec3a25b4fa253081d3:0
- 3c43fca70fb06b01c96f5b2cc67eaf08cee909ebdf5e37ec3a25b4fa253081d3:1
value 75107
address 18JEjq2ijVfmfjuPhwFA41uTMRrYvcZATv
value 2994772
address 3BrZwPDC2oUxyMMS8UTBhrY4Y5b2xbPAAg